Role Description

The Senior Staff Engineer operates at the critical intersection of product engineering, commercial strategy, and real-time operations. You will be responsible for managing the day-to-day dispatch, performance, and revenue optimization of our utility-scale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) portfolio. You will translate complex physical asset constraints, including battery state of health, inverter limits, operational constraints, and degradation curves, into dynamic market bidding and revenue-stacking strategies across wholesale energy markets. Serving as the primary link and interface between external market stakeholders and internal engineering teams (Reliability Engineering, Field Service), you will ensure our BESS portfolio deliver maximum financial value while maintaining grid compliance and long-term asset health.

What you'll do:
  • Direct BESS portfolio dispatch, managing SOC and market awards within physical system limits.
  • Execute revenue-stacking across wholesale energy, capacity, and ancillary services to maximize returns, including acting as the primary contact for ISO/RTOs and QSE/SCs
  • Ensure all dispatch actions, system settings, and operations comply with grid codes, interconnection agreements, and NERC standards.
  • Partner with Reliability Engineering to integrate degradation modeling into dispatch logic.
  • Monitor SCADA, EMS, PCS, and BMS data streams to identify underperformance or operational anomalies.
  • Coordinate preventive maintenance and fault resolution with the Field Service team to maximize system uptime.
  • Troubleshoot unexpected trips, communication drops, or curtailments, directing safe returns-to-service with the Field Service team.
  • Conduct post-dispatch reviews to evaluate asset performance, quantify financial returns, and tune bidding & dispatch logic.
  • Lead or support root cause analyses (RCA) for major operational incidents, distilling technical findings into actionable improvement plans.
What you'll bring:
  • 10+ years in utility-scale BESS operations, renewable asset management, energy trading, or power plant dispatch.
  • Technical expertise in BESS architecture (string balancing, PCS, EMS control loops) and SCADA protocols (DNP3, Modbus, IEC 61850).
  • Knowledge of ISO/RTO market structures, bidding protocols, settlement rules, and ancillary services.
  • Experience balancing market revenue with long-term asset health.
  • Proficiency analyzing high-frequency operational time-series data using Python, SQL, or MATLAB.
  • Exceptional communication skills to bridge product engineering, field service, and power market operators.
  • Strong situational awareness and decision-making in fast-paced, real-time environments.
  • Bachelor's degree or higher in Electrical Engineering, Power Systems Engineering, or a related quantitative engineering field.
